AnyPicker
AnyPicker is a Chrome extension for visual web scraping that allows users to select elements visually and export data directly from the browser.
Magical
Magical is an AI productivity app that automates repetitive data transfer, autofills forms, and syncs info between browser tabs instantly.

🎯 AnyPicker is best for
Non-technical users looking to extract ad-hoc data from web pages directly within Chrome without installing third-party software.
🎯 Magical is best for
Sales reps, recruiters, and customer support agents who spend hours copy-pasting data between open browser tabs and web CRMs.
